Responsibilities
  • Oversee the full scope of e‑discovery workflows, from preservation and collection through processing, review, and production. This includes developing and executing project plans, managing timelines and budgets, and ensuring that all work is completed in accordance with applicable legal standards, court rules, and client guidelines.
  • Collaborate with litigation teams to design and implement Technology Assisted Review (TAR) and other AI‑driven review workflows.
  • Leverage Relativity aiR for Review to enhance document review efficiency by integrating AI‑powered review capabilities into existing workflows, evaluating the suitability of aiR for Review on a matter‑by‑matter basis, configuring and monitoring its deployment, and providing reporting on its performance and impact.
  • Advise attorneys on best practices for defensible deployment of AI tools, assist in drafting related protocols for submission to courts, maintain a firm grasp of relevant validation statistics, and oversee quality control and validation of AI‑assisted review results.
  • Serve as a primary point of contact for all e‑discovery‑related communications, opposing counsel, and clients. This includes advising at meet‑and‑confer discussions on ESI issues, and ensuring compliance with ESI protocols and protective orders.
  • Additional responsibilities include developing and maintaining project documentation, preparing status reports and metrics for stakeholders, conducting quality assurance checks on all data deliverables, and mentoring junior team members on e‑discovery best practices and technology platforms.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ree required; a Juris Doctor (JD), paralegal certificate, or advanced degree in a related field is preferred.
  • A current Relativity Certified Administrator (RCA) certification is required. Additional Relativity certifications, such as Relativity Certified User (RCU) or Relativity Analytics Specialist, are highly valued.
  • Minimum of seven (7) years of increasing responsibility in e‑discovery project management, with a substantial portion of that experience gained within a large law firm (BigLaw) environment.
  • Must possess expert‑level proficiency in the Relativity platform, including workspace setup and administration, search functionality, review coding layouts, productions, and analytics features such as clustering, email threading, and conceptual indexing. Experience with Relativity's suite of aiR products—including aiR for Review, aiR for Privilege, and aiR for Case Strategy—is strongly preferred.
  • Significant experience designing, implementing, and managing Technology Assisted Review (TAR) workflows is essential. This includes familiarity with TAR 2.0 / Continuous Active Learning (CAL) methodologies, as well as the ability to articulate and defend TAR processes and statistically relevant validation measures—such as recall, precision, F1 score, elusion rate, richness/prevalence, confidence intervals, and margins of error—in the context of litigation.
